Q: Is 293,229 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 293,229 is a composite number.

Why is 293,229 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 293,229 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 31 93 279 1,051 3,153 9,459 32,581 97,743 and 293,229, with no remainder.

Since 293,229 cannot be divided by just 1 and 293,229, it is a composite number.
